Finance Cloud Platform Comparison: ERP Suite vs Modular Architecture for Control
Finance leaders evaluating a modern cloud platform are often not choosing between two products alone. They are choosing between two operating models: an integrated ERP suite that centralizes finance and adjacent processes, or a modular architecture that assembles best-of-breed applications around accounting, planning, procurement, billing, treasury, and analytics. In this comparison, Odoo is best understood as a suite-oriented platform with modular deployment flexibility. That makes it relevant for organizations seeking control, process standardization, and lower integration overhead without committing to the cost profile of many upper-midmarket enterprise suites.
The strategic question is not simply which option has more features. The more important issue is where control should live: inside one extensible system of record, or across a coordinated application landscape. For CFOs, CIOs, and transformation leaders, that decision affects governance, reporting consistency, implementation speed, compliance posture, and long-term total cost of ownership. Odoo enters this discussion as a practical finance cloud ERP option for companies that want broad process coverage, configurable workflows, and deployment flexibility while avoiding excessive platform fragmentation.
How to frame the decision
An ERP suite approach typically prioritizes unified data models, shared workflows, common security, and lower dependency on third-party connectors. A modular architecture prioritizes specialized functionality, selective replacement, and the ability to adopt category-leading tools for each finance domain. Neither model is universally superior. The right fit depends on transaction complexity, regulatory requirements, internal IT maturity, growth plans, and tolerance for integration management.

Pricing considerations: subscription cost is only the visible layer
In finance cloud platform comparison exercises, pricing is often misread because buyers compare license line items rather than the full architecture cost. ERP suites usually present a more consolidated commercial model, while modular environments can appear less expensive at entry because teams buy only what they need. However, modular pricing frequently expands through connector fees, middleware subscriptions, implementation services, analytics tooling, support contracts, and duplicated administration effort.
Odoo is often attractive in this context because its pricing structure can support broad functional adoption without requiring separate contracts for every adjacent process. For organizations that need accounting, invoicing, purchasing, inventory, approvals, CRM, projects, and reporting in one environment, the economics can compare favorably against assembling multiple finance applications. That said, if a company only needs a narrow accounting layer and already has mature surrounding systems, a modular architecture may preserve prior investments more efficiently.

Total cost of ownership: where architecture decisions become financial decisions
TCO should be evaluated over at least five years and should include software, implementation, integration, support, internal administration, reporting reconciliation, audit effort, and upgrade management. In many finance organizations, the hidden cost of modular architecture is not the subscription itself but the operational friction created by disconnected master data, inconsistent approval logic, and delayed close cycles. These costs rarely appear in procurement spreadsheets, yet they materially affect finance productivity and control.
An ERP suite such as Odoo can lower TCO when the business benefits from shared workflows across accounting, procurement, sales, inventory, subscriptions, field service, or manufacturing. The more cross-functional the process landscape, the stronger the suite economics become. Conversely, if the organization has highly specialized finance requirements already served by mature niche tools, replacing them with a suite may increase transition cost without delivering proportional value. TCO therefore depends on process overlap, not just software price.
Implementation complexity: broad platform design versus integration orchestration
ERP suite implementations are often perceived as more complex because they require process harmonization across departments. That perception is partly true. A suite forces decisions on chart of accounts structure, approval policies, procurement controls, inventory valuation, intercompany logic, and reporting ownership. Those decisions take time. However, modular architecture does not eliminate complexity; it redistributes it into integration mapping, data synchronization, workflow handoffs, and exception handling between systems.
Odoo implementations tend to be most successful when organizations adopt a phased model: finance foundation first, then procurement, inventory, sales operations, projects, or manufacturing based on business priority. This approach preserves suite integrity while reducing deployment risk. By contrast, modular finance stacks can move quickly for a single function such as AP automation or FP&A, but complexity rises as more tools are added and governance becomes fragmented.
Customization and control: standardization should not mean rigidity
Control in finance platforms depends on more than permissions. It depends on whether workflows, approvals, data structures, and reporting logic can be adapted without creating an unmaintainable environment. ERP suites vary significantly here. Some are strong in standard process control but expensive to tailor. Odoo is differentiated by its balance between standard modules and extensibility. Organizations can configure workflows, automate approvals, extend data models, and build role-specific experiences without necessarily introducing the same level of complexity found in heavier enterprise platforms.
Modular architecture offers another form of flexibility: the ability to choose specialized tools for each process. That can be advantageous for treasury, tax, revenue recognition, or advanced planning where niche depth matters. The tradeoff is that customization becomes distributed. Finance teams may gain local optimization but lose enterprise-wide consistency. For companies prioritizing control, auditability, and operational coherence, a configurable suite often provides a stronger governance model than a loosely connected stack.

Integration and analytics: the real test of finance control
Finance control weakens when reporting depends on stitched data from multiple systems with different timing, ownership, and definitions. In modular environments, analytics often require a separate data platform or BI layer to reconcile transactions, dimensions, and operational metrics. That is not inherently negative, but it adds architecture and governance demands. ERP suites reduce some of this burden by keeping more transactions native to one platform.
Odoo is particularly effective when organizations want operational and financial reporting to align without extensive middleware. Sales, purchasing, inventory, projects, subscriptions, and accounting can feed a more coherent reporting model. Companies with advanced enterprise analytics requirements may still layer external BI tools on top, but the underlying data consistency is often easier to manage than in a fragmented modular stack.
Migration considerations: modernization should reduce complexity, not relocate it
Migration strategy should begin with architecture rationalization. If the current environment includes legacy accounting software, spreadsheets, disconnected procurement tools, and manual reporting workarounds, moving to an ERP suite can be a simplification program as much as a software replacement. Odoo is often a strong candidate in these scenarios because it can consolidate multiple point solutions into one extensible platform.
If the current state already includes high-performing specialist systems with deep process fit, a modular target architecture may be more practical. In that case, Odoo may still serve as a core ERP layer, but the migration design should preserve systems that create measurable strategic value. Key migration factors include master data quality, chart of accounts redesign, historical transaction strategy, integration retirement plans, user training, and governance for customizations. The objective is not to replicate legacy complexity in a new cloud environment.
Realistic business scenarios
- A multi-entity distributor with fragmented purchasing, inventory, and accounting processes will usually gain more control from an ERP suite such as Odoo than from adding more finance point solutions. Shared workflows and native operational-financial integration improve close accuracy and working capital visibility.
- A digital services firm with straightforward accounting but advanced FP&A, subscription billing, and revenue recognition needs may prefer a modular architecture if specialist tools materially outperform suite-native capabilities in those domains.
- A growing eCommerce company managing orders, stock, returns, invoicing, and customer service often benefits from Odoo because finance control depends on operational data integrity, not accounting alone.
- A mature enterprise with a strong internal architecture team and strict preference for category-leading applications may choose modular architecture, provided it is willing to invest in integration governance, data management, and support coordination.
